Cardinal Wolsey
- Written by: Mandell Creighton
- Original Recording
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
This podcast dives deep into the life of Cardinal Thomas Wolsey (1473-1530), the Lord Chancellor who met his downfall when he couldnt secure King Henry VIIIs marriage annulment to Catherine of Aragon. Noted British historian, Mandell Creighton, paints Wolsey as a figure condemned by Tudor historians as the minion of the Pope, and the upholder of a foreign despotism. However, an abundance of documents unveiled in the 19th century related to Henry VIIIs reign allowed for a more accurate portrayal of Wolseys ambitious plans and his ingrained patriotism. Saint Charles Borromeo- Reforming Cardinal
- Written by: Louise M. Stacpoole-Kenny
- Original Recording
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
Charles Borromeo served as the cardinal archbishop of the Catholic Archdiocese of Milan from 1564 to 1584, emerging as a pivotal leader during the Counter-Reformation. His dedication to reforming the Catholic Church was profound, as he established seminaries aimed at educating future priests. Revered as a saint within the Catholic tradition, his feast day is celebrated on November 4. (Summary from Wikipedia)

Life and Death of Cardinal Wolsey
- Written by: George Cavendish
- Original Recording
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
Immerse yourself in the riveting life story of Thomas Wolsey, an influential English statesman, Catholic bishop, and Cardinal appointed by Pope Leo X in 1515. His dramatic fall from grace was brought about by his failure to secure an annulment for King Henry VIIIs marriage to Catherine of Aragon, paving the way for Anne Boleyns rise. As Wolseys Gentleman Usher, George Cavendish produced an invaluable account of these highly significant events in English history, establishing himself as one of the first great English biographers.
